Be sure to stop by and visit our Stitch
'n Zip trunkshow from Alice Peterson. They are available in our
on-line
catalog so you can view the photos and/or order on-line if you're not able
to make it into the shop. The full kits come with the pre-finished silkscreen
design, threads, needle and instructions. Just stitch it up and if you want,
you can add some fabric to the inside when you're done to make an even nicer
finish. We also have blank pre-finished kits for the sizes that come that way
so you can create your own design. These are all 18 mesh on interlock canvas.
The thread in the kits is DMC floss and you don't even need to strip them down
- just stitch with all 6 strands intact.

The book Patterns of Fashion
#4 (by Janet Arnold) mentioned above contains the pattern for a jacket very
much like the Plimoth
Plantation jacket. Tricia recommended the book when she was out teaching
this spring and it's got some great drawings of historical clothing.
